[0030] Example 1
[0031] The ingredients are as follows: 30kg of ginger powder, 200kg of lemon juice (Bix45. Lot No. 6163538, produced in Israel Gate Food Company), 3kg of wheat oligopeptide powder, 10kg of taurine, 20kg of creatine, 20kg of oligomaltose, 200kg of dried fruit syrup, 10kg of isomaltulose, 15kg of vitamin B family including vitamin B1, vitamin B2, vitamin B6 and vitamin B12.
[0032] The production process is as follows:
[0033] 1. Soak the ginger powder in hot water at 80-85℃ for 20-30 minutes, then filter (use a 100-mesh sieve) to extract the gingerol as much as possible, and set aside.

[0037] Experimental Example 1
[0038] The beverage prepared in Example 1 was taken as the test group A, and the aqueous solution with sweetener was taken as the control group B; the beverage prepared according to Example 1 with the same raw material without ginger powder was taken as the control group C. A total of 26 male middle and long-distance runners from a sports school in Hebei, aged 16-19, with a training period of 2 years, were used as the experimental subjects.
[0039] Experimental method: The athletes were randomly divided into two groups: experimental group A (9 people), control group B (8 people) and control group C (9 people). The experimental group took 350ml of the beverage prepared in Example 1 every morning and noon; the control group took a placebo for three consecutive weeks. During the period of taking, the experimental group and the control group had the same amount of training b.c.
